#6 James Hendricks
Class: Junior
Position: Free Safety
Height: 6'1"
Weight: 209
Hometown: Bemidji, Minn.
High School: Bemidji HS

2017 SEASON (SOPHOMORE): Filled a variety of roles while playing in all 15 games in his first season on the defensive side of the ball...Made his first career start at strong safety against South Dakota State before moving to the starting will linebacker position the following week against South Dakota...Also maintained his position as the emergency quarterback throughout the year, taking snaps late in the Robert Morris game...Made 36 tackles including 23 solo stops...Intercepted four passes in the first five games of the season...Season-high five tackles in four different games.

2016 SEASON (FRESHMAN): Third-string quarterback behind starter Easton Stick and backup Cole Davis...Saw brief action late in the home win over Indiana State...Also played special teams for the Bison in a second round playoff victory over San Diego...Moved from quarterback to safety for 2017 spring practice.

2015 SEASON (REDSHIRT): Sat out the season as a redshirt in the Bison program.

HIGH SCHOOL: Three-year starter and four-year letterman at Bemidji, where his father is the head football coach and activities director...Passed for 3,735 yards and 36 touchdowns while rushing for 2,273 yards and 25 TDs in his career...Two-time all-conference and three-time all-section performer...Minnesota Vikings all-state selection...Led the Lumberjacks to a pair of nine-win seasons and two section championships...Bemidji advanced to the 2012 Class 5A state semifinals and 2014 state quarterfinals.

PERSONAL: Majoring in business administration...Son of Troy and Suzann Hendricks of Bemidji, Minn...Youngest of three children...Has a sister, Abby, and a brother, Mitch, who was a three-year starting quarterback at Division III Gustavus Adolphus College...Father was a national scoring and rushing champion, 1985 NSIC co-Offensive Player of the Year, and NAIA All-America running back for Minnesota State Moorhead.

#6 JOE CASALE



http://image.cdnllnwnl.xosnetwork.com/pics33/400/PS/PSRWFOUXLMCMHWA.20180815175125.jpg




Position: Defensive Back
Height: 6'2"
Weight: 192
Year: Freshman
Hometown: Troy, N.Y.
High School: Troy


High school: At Troy High, played four years of football and basketball as well as two years of baseball. Also ran track for two years. ... As a senior totaled 82 tackles, six interceptions, four forced fumbles and two defensive touchdowns for the Class AA New York State champions. ... Played defensive back and quarterback in his career. On defense totaled 224 tackles, 21 interceptions, nine forced fumbles and two defensive touchdowns. As a QB, completed 104-of-164 passes for 1,561 yards and 21 touchdowns. ... Senior awards included: New York State High School Football Coaches Association Class AA Player of the Year, New York State Sports Writers Association First-Team All-State Defensive Back, USA Today New York All-State First-Team Defensive Back, Times Union Large Schools Defensive Player of the Year, Liberty League Defensive MVP and New York State AA Championship Game "Spectrum Player of the Game."


Personal: Son of Mack and Kathy Casale. ... Has two brothers, Anthony and Dave, as well as two sisters, Alyssa and Natalia. ... His brother, Dave, played football at UAlbany from 2004 to 2009, appearing in 46 games at safety and recording 11 interceptions with 124 tackles. ... Intends to major in business.
